Output 3bfad23a9bc843b1a060a1c289a735cee576b4258cd5a11c30e7ec1ab2ee53a2:100

value
64261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ccefa5ccfd514a962265e7f4cc5fe6ebbfc05e6 OP_EQUAL
address
3BcLrLsqoTLTM3krpCAnojtdtog4Y8aLhT
transaction
3bfad23a9bc843b1a060a1c289a735cee576b4258cd5a11c30e7ec1ab2ee53a2
confirmations
159768
spent
true